Polarization conversion of metal-helix based metamaterials can be eliminated by recovering four-fold rotational symmetry. Symmetry considerations and current progress in the fabrication of N-helix optical metamaterials as broadband circular polarizers is presented.
Tapering is shown to further extend the bandwidth of three-dimensional gold-helix metamaterials as broadband circular polarizers to about 1.5 octaves. Furthermore, the extinction ratio is improved. Theory and experiment show good agreement.
